Only government employees (central or state) who joined service before January 1, 2004, qualify for OPS. New recruits are automatically enrolled in the New Pension Scheme (NPS).

Eligibility. The applicant should be a permanent resident of Himachal Pradesh. The age of the applicant should be 60 years or more.

A) on completion of 30 years of qualifying service; or (b) on attaining the age of- (i) 50 years in respect of Class-I and Class-II Officers who have entered in Government service before attaining the age of thirty five years; and (ii) 55 years in case of all other Class-I, Class-II, Class-III .

"Provided further that a Class-IV Government servant appointed on part-time/ daily wages basis prior to 10-05-2001 and regularized on or after 10-05-2001 shall retire from service on the afternoon of the last day of the month in which he attains the age of 60 years."

Himachal Pradesh Government has provided 15% reservation to Ex-servicemen in Class I to Class IV posts in all services of the State Government including Public Sector Undertakings/Corporations and Autonomous Bodies.

In Himachal Pradesh, the women above 60 years of age are covered under the old age pension. Women in the age group 60 to 69 receive Rs 1,500 monthly pension, and those aged 70 years and above get Rs 1,700.
